The hexadecimal color code #717784 corresponds to the code RGB( 113, 119, 132 ). It's a shade of Gray. This color is a combination of red (at 0,44 level), green (at 0,47 level) and blue (at 0,52 level). Its brightness is 48% and its saturation is 7%. It is composed of red at 31%, green at 32% and blue at 36%.
